Obtain a valid ticket, for example with `kinit`, then create or edit a Trino connection and choose **Kerberos** as its authentication method. The service name defaults to `HTTP`; set it or the hostname override only when your server's Kerberos principal requires different values. Mutual authentication uses the selected driver's default unless explicitly overridden. Select **GSSAPI** instead when your environment requires the `requests-gssapi` implementation, after installing `trino[gssapi]`; sqlit derives its default service target from `HTTP` and the configured Trino hostname.
